HS Code for Artificial sewing thread

5508.20 Sewing thread; of artificial staple fibres, whether or not put up for retail sale

HS code 550820 is specifically designated for sewing thread made from artificial staple fibers, irrespective of whether it is put up for retail sale. Artificial staple fibers are man-made fibers (e.g., rayon, modal, lyocell) that have been cut into short lengths, similar to natural fibers. The classification emphasizes two key aspects: the material (artificial staple fibers) and the form (sewing thread). This ensures precise categorization, differentiating it from sewing threads made of synthetic staple fibers or from yarns not intended for sewing.

Products Included

  • Sewing thread made from rayon staple fibers
  • Sewing thread composed of modal staple fibers
  • Lyocell staple fiber sewing thread
  • Sewing thread of regenerated cellulose staple fibers, on spools or cones
  • Industrial sewing thread of artificial staple fibers, not for retail

Common Misclassification

Common misclassifications often involve HS code 550810, which covers sewing thread of synthetic staple fibers. The distinction lies in the fiber type: 550820 is for artificial (regenerated cellulose-based) staple fibers, while 550810 is for synthetic (polymer-based, e.g., polyester, nylon) staple fibers. Another point of confusion can be with yarns of artificial staple fibers (Chapter 55, e.g., 5510) that are not specifically sewing thread. Sewing thread is characterized by its strength, twist, and finish, making it suitable for stitching, unlike general yarns. Additionally, sewing thread of artificial filaments (5406) is distinct as it uses continuous filaments rather than staple fibers.

What is the difference between artificial and synthetic sewing thread?

Artificial sewing thread (550820) is made from regenerated cellulose staple fibers (e.g., rayon). Synthetic sewing thread (550810) is made from synthetic polymer staple fibers (e.g., polyester, nylon).

Is the HS code for Artificial sewing thread the same in all countries?

The base HS code 550820 for Artificial sewing thread is internationally standardized for the first 6 digits across 200+ countries. Individual countries may add additional digits for national tariff lines and specific classifications.
